11.00 Change Log Notes:
  • Fixed an issue where Heart Rate broadcast would stop working after 10 seconds, if returning to the watch face from the Sensors and accessories menu. \
  • Fixed an issue where GPS related training options were accessible from certain indoor sports.
  • Fixed an issue where the device could crash when processing malformed activity files.
  • Fixed an issue where certain settings changes on device were not making it to Garmin Connect as expected.
  • Fixed an occasional issue where the displayed lengths or distance during a pool swim could briefly show incorrect values.

  • I've tested the bike ride elevation of the identical ride on two days. The ride is approximately 26 miles long round trip.

    Day 1, the watch reported 1102 feet total climb. Garmin Connect elevation corrected the ride to 1150 feet and Strava elevation corrected the ride to 1228 feet.
    Day 2, the watch reported 1086 feet total climb. Garmin Connect elevation corrected the ride to 1163 feet and Strava elevation corrected the ride to 1213 feet.

    These results seem more consistent than other firmware versions.
